首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 操作系统 > UNIXLINUX >

fdisk 命令 能否 进行 非交互模式,比如 #fdisk /dev/sdb n p 0 100M;创建一个分区。该如何解决

2012-04-24 
fdisk 命令 能否进行 非交互模式,比如 #:fdisk /dev/sdb n p 0 100M创建一个分区。我想问下fdisk有没有非

fdisk 命令 能否 进行 非交互模式,比如 #:fdisk /dev/sdb n p 0 100M;创建一个分区。
我想问下 fdisk 有没有非交互 模式,就好比 parted 命令一行。

这样 ,如果 想 分配一个分区,就不用 烦琐的输入, 只需要 输入 一行命令就可以了。而且执行完毕后 
又返回到命令行状态。
[color=#800000]FDISK 一般执行步骤:[/color][b][/b]
 fdisk /dev/sdb

Command (m for help): n
Command action
  e extended
  p primary partition (1-4)
p
Partition number (1-4): 1
First cylinder (1-1009, default 1): 
Using default value 1
Last cylinder or +size or +sizeM or +sizeK (1-1009, default 1009): +100M

能否 一次 输入,中间没有交互,类似 下面的执行方式。[b][/b]
fdisk n p 1 0 100M



 

[解决办法]
貌似没听过可以这样.
[解决办法]
当然可以,在实际开发中常要这么干:
将你要在fdisk命令行输入的命令实现写入一个文本文件,比如叫做fdiskcmd.txt 

对于你的例子,fdiskcmd.txt的内容如下:

C/C++ code
np10100Mw 

热点排行